MSc Mathematics Distance Education Syllabus
MSc in Mathematics is a specialized program to get advanced knowledge and skills in the field of Mathematics. Its syllabus is divided in the duration of 2 years, which is also divided into four semesters of duration 6 months each.
Students study various core subjects in this program, including real analysis, advanced abstract algebra, fundamentals of research, Theory of differential equations, fundamentals of information technology, complex analysis, research methods and designs, calculus of variation and integral equations, partial differentiation equations, numerical analysis, differential geometry, mathematical statistics, etc.
